Before the hurricane: Moscow, November 7, 1987, the Warsaw Pact despots celebrate the 70th anniversary of the Bolshevik coup (the prropaganda fiction named „The Great Socialist October Revolution”).
With the exception of Mikhail Gorbachev, they are all decrepit.
They despise each other, but, more than anything else, they fear the winds of change. One week later, In Brasov, a workers’ demonstration defies Ceausescu’s paranoid regime. Solidarnosc has resurrected in Poland.
Independent peace movement get increasingly vocal in the GDR. Hungary’s Democratic Opposition challenges the slanderous lies about the 1956 Revolution. Civil society is reborn in all these countries. The end of the Soviet Bloc is imminent, the storm can’t be arrested…
